Norfolk Island vs Vestervig Climate & Distance Between

Denmark flag
  • The distance between Norfolk Island, Australia and Vestervig, Denmark is approximately 16,543 km or 10,280 mi.
  • To reach Norfolk Island in this distance one would set out from Vestervig bearing 36°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Norfolk Island bearing 158.4° or SSE .
  • Norfolk Island has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Vestervig has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• The mean temperature is 11.1 °C (20°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 9.7 °C (17.5°F) less in Norfolk Island.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 503.6 mm (19.8 in) more which is equivalent to 503.6 l/m² (12.36 US gal/ft²) or 5,036,000 l/ha (538,382 US gal/ac) more. About 1 5/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 26.9° higher in Norfolk Island than in Vestervig.
